+void
+LibDHCP::initStdOptionDefs6(OptionDefContainer& defs) {
+ defs.clear();
+
+ struct OptionParams {
+ std::string name;
+ uint16_t code;
+ OptionDefinition::DataType type;
+ bool array;
+ };
+ OptionParams params[] = {
+ { "CLIENTID", D6O_CLIENTID, OptionDefinition::BINARY_TYPE, false },
+ { "SERVERID", D6O_SERVERID, OptionDefinition::BINARY_TYPE, false },
+ { "IA_NA", D6O_IA_NA, OptionDefinition::RECORD_TYPE, false },
+ { "IAADDR", D6O_IAADDR, OptionDefinition::RECORD_TYPE, false },
+ { "ORO", D6O_ORO, OptionDefinition::UINT16_TYPE, true },
+ { "ELAPSED_TIME", D6O_ELAPSED_TIME, OptionDefinition::UINT16_TYPE, false },
+ { "STATUS_CODE", D6O_STATUS_CODE, OptionDefinition::RECORD_TYPE, false },
+ { "RAPID_COMMIT", D6O_RAPID_COMMIT, OptionDefinition::EMPTY_TYPE, false },
+ { "DNS_SERVERS", D6O_NAME_SERVERS, OptionDefinition::IPV6_ADDRESS_TYPE, true }
+ };
+ const int params_size = sizeof(params) / sizeof(params[0]);
+
+ for (int i = 0; i < params_size; ++i) {
+ OptionDefinitionPtr definition(new OptionDefinition(params[i].name,
+ params[i].code,
+ params[i].type,
+ params[i].array));
+ switch(params[i].code) {
+ case D6O_IA_NA:
+ for (int j = 0; j < 3; ++j) {
+ definition->addRecordField(OptionDefinition::UINT32_TYPE);
+ }
+ break;
+ case D6O_IAADDR:
+ definition->addRecordField(OptionDefinition::IPV6_ADDRESS_TYPE);
+ definition->addRecordField(OptionDefinition::UINT32_TYPE);
+ definition->addRecordField(OptionDefinition::UINT32_TYPE);
+ break;
+ case D6O_STATUS_CODE:
+ definition->addRecordField(OptionDefinition::UINT16_TYPE);
+ definition->addRecordField(OptionDefinition::STRING_TYPE);
+ default:
+ break;
+ }
+ defs.push_back(definition);
+ }
+}

+/// @brief Multi index container for DHCP option definitions.
+///
+/// This container allows to search for DHCP option definition
+/// using two indexes:
+/// - sequenced: used to access elements in the oreder they have
+/// been added to the container
+/// - option code: used to search defintions of options
+/// with a specified option code (aka option type).
+///
+/// @todo: need an index to search options using option space name
+/// once option spaces are implemented.
+typedef boost::multi_index_container<
+ // Container comprises elements of OptionDefinition type.
+ OptionDefinitionPtr,
+ // Here we start enumerating various indexes.
+ boost::multi_index::indexed_by<
+ // Sequenced index allows accessing elements in the same way
+ // as elements in std::list. Sequenced is an index #0.
+ boost::multi_index::sequenced<>,
+ // Start definition of index #1.
+ boost::multi_index::hashed_non_unique<
+ // Use option type as the index key. The type is held
+ // in OptionDefinition object so we have to call
+ // OptionDefinition::getCode to retrieve this key
+ // for each element.
+ boost::multi_index::const_mem_fun<
+ OptionDefinition,
+ uint16_t,
+ &OptionDefinition::getCode
+ >
+ >
+ >
+> OptionDefContainer;
+
+/// Type of the index #1 - option type.
+typedef OptionDefContainer::nth_index<1>::type OptionDefContainerTypeIndex;
+/// Pair of iterators to represent the range of options definitions
+/// having the same option type value. The first element in this pair
+/// represents the begining of the range, the second element
+/// represents the end.
+typedef std::pair<OptionDefContainerTypeIndex::const_iterator,
+ OptionDefContainerTypeIndex::const_iterator> OptionDefContainerTypeRange;
